An addict should start a rehabilitation program and sometimes detoxification programs are necessary in order to adjust the body to its drug-free state. There are several rehab and addiction treatment options used by professional therapists these days and counselors will work closely with the addict to find the most suitable Drug Abuse Treatment. This will be chosen based on individual needs and to goal is to help the former addict to accept the drug-free life as soon as possible. Among the most popular treatment options there are psychotherapy, which is very important when it comes to helping the patient how to resist, support groups and individual counseling.

 

Most drinkers feel that no one understands what they are going through and this is why they should be guided by en experienced peer throughout the first sobriety steps. Indeed, support groups are meant to help addicts find comfort and understanding, without fearing that they will be judged.
